<br />o <br /> <br />o <br /> <br />o <br /> <br />REGULAR SEMI-MONTHLY MEETING OF THE <br />CITY COUNCIL OF ELK RIVER <br />HEID IN THE COUNCIL CHAMBERS OF THE CITY OFFICE BLDG. <br /> <br />May 19, 1975 at 7:30 PM. <br /> <br />The Regular Semi-Monthly meeting of the Elk River City Council was called to order by <br />Mayor Lundberg on May 5th 1975 at 7:30 PM in the Council Chambers of the City Office <br />Bldg. Members present were as follows: Mayor Lundberg, Councilmembers Konop, Hudson, <br />Syring and otto. <br /> <br />The minutes of the May 5, 1975 meeting were reviewed the motion pertaining to the land <br />purchase request of the County should read and authorize the Mayor to execute the legal <br />documents of sale. <br /> <br />The Council reviewed the Planning Commission recommendations regarding variance request <br />on side yards to construct garages by Ken Nelson and Gary Peterson. Council had no <br />objections and approve the issuance of the bldg. permits. <br /> <br />Moved by Councilmember Konop and seconded by Councilmember Hudson granting the issuance <br />of a 1 day (July 4, 1975) non-intoxicating on sale beer lic. to the Elk River J.C's. <br />Motion unanimously carried by a vote of 5-0. <br /> <br />Dan Greene and Al Froehlich were in attendance for opening of the rate schedule for <br />payment plans on the City Insurance resently let for bids. <br />The following rate schedules were reviewed: <br /> <br />1 st State Insurance Agency <br />1 stNat 'I Insurance Agency <br />-see attached schedules- <br /> <br />Moved by Councilmember Syring and seconded by Councilmember otto awarding the City <br />Insurance bid to 1st National Insurance Agency, Dan Greene, Manager to be effective <br />June 15, 1975 subject to final approval of the policies in there final form. Motion <br />unanimously carried by a vote of 5-0. <br /> <br />Rex Oetinger Bldg. Inspector met with the CoUncil regarding Georges Super Valu he stated <br />that as of todays date he still doesn't have a set of plans or site survey of the project. <br />The Mayor said that he would contact Mr. Kreuser. <br /> <br />Skip McCombs, City Engineer met with the Council and presented his report on the Frontage <br />Road project,,' <br /> <br />Moved by Councilmember Syring and seconded by Councilmember Otto calling for the plans <br />and specifications on the Frontage Road project. Motion unanimoUsly carried by a vote of <br />5-0. <br /> <br />Moved by Councilmember Hudson and seconded by Councilmember Syring approving the payment <br />request #9 of Elview Const. Inc. in the amount of $27,819.90 as recommended by the architic <br />Motion unanimously carried by a vote of lv-O. <br /> <br />Moved by Couneilmember otto and seconded by Councilmember Syring approving Northwestern <br />Bells request to bury cable on Meadowvale Road and Upland Ave. Motion unanimously carried <br />by a vote of 5-0. <br /> <br />Moved by Councilmember Hudson and seconded by Councilmember Konop approving the preliminary <br />plot plan for Oak Hills 2nd Addition as recommended',by the Planning Commission. Motion <br />unanimously carried by a vote of 5-0. <br />
